Best Photography Spots

St Kilda Pier

Iconic pier extending into Port Phillip Bay, perfect for sunrise city skyline shots, little penguin sightings at dusk, and long exposure seascapes.

Flinders Street Station

Historic railway station with grand architecture, clocks, and bustling street life ideal for urban and street photography.

Luna Park Melbourne

Vintage amusement park with colorful rides and art deco entrance, great for long exposure light trails and nostalgic vibes.

Yarra River Banks

Riverside paths with city skyline reflections, bridges, and rowers; excellent for landscape and urban fusion shots.

Brighton Beach Bathing Boxes

Row of colorful historic beach huts, iconic for vibrant coastal photography.

Royal Botanic Gardens

Expansive gardens with lakes, exotic plants, and city views; ideal for nature and landscape photography.

Eureka Skydeck

High-rise observation deck with 360° city views, perfect for skyline panoramas.

Hosier Lane

Famous street art alley with vibrant murals, a must for urban street photography.

Queen Victoria Market

Bustling market with food stalls, crowds, and architecture for street and lifestyle shots.

Melbourne Shrine of Remembrance

War memorial atop hill with panoramic city views and poignant architecture.

Hidden Gems

St Kilda Breakwater

Rugged extension beyond main pier for dramatic wave crashes and isolated skyline views.

AC/DC Lane

Quiet street art alley tribute to the band, less crowded than Hosier.

Princes Bridge Arches

Undercroft arches along Yarra with graffiti and river reflections.

Middle Park Beach

Quiet beach north of St Kilda with pier views and bathing boxes alternative.

Trip Planning

# Trip Planning for Jan 3-4, 2026 **Transportation:** Myki card for trams/trains/buses ($10+ load); free City Circle Tram in CBD. Walk or e-scooters in compact areas. Airports: Tullamarine (T1 international, T4 domestic), 30-min SkyBus to city ($20). **Logistics:** 2-day trip covers CBD Day 1 (sunrise pier, day urban, sunset skyline), St Kilda Day 2. Summer heat (25-30°C), hydrate/sunscreen. Markets open Wed (Queen Vic 6AM-2PM Jan 3? Check site). **Safety/Permits:** Low crime, but watch gear in crowds; no drone permits in most public spots without CASA approval. No general photography permits needed.[2][4][5] **Accommodation:** CBD or St Kilda for proximity.
